.
QQ扫一扫联系
Vue中的SVG图标与图标库使用
在现代Web开发中,图标在界面设计和用户体验中起着重要的作用。Vue作为一种流行的前端框架,提供了多种方法来使用SVG图标和图标库,使我们能够轻松地集成高质量的矢量图标到Vue应用程序中。本文将介绍Vue中使用SVG图标和图标库的重要性,并详细讨论一些常用的技巧和工具。
SVG(可缩放矢量图形)是一种基于XML的矢量图形格式,它具有良好的扩展性和可缩放性。在Vue中使用SVG图标具有以下优势:
可缩放性:SVG图标是矢量图形,可以在不损失清晰度的情况下进行任意缩放。这使得SVG图标在不同尺寸的屏幕上显示效果良好,并且适用于响应式设计。
矢量化:SVG图标由数学描述组成,而不是像素。这意味着SVG图标可以无损地在不同分辨率的设备上显示,并保持清晰度和细节。
自定义样式:SVG图标可以通过CSS样式进行自定义,包括颜色、大小、阴影等。这使得我们可以灵活地根据应用程序的设计需求修改SVG图标的外观。
使用图标库可以进一步简化SVG图标的使用和管理。图标库是一个集合了大量高质量的SVG图标的资源,提供了方便的图标获取和管理方式。
以下是一些常用的Vue中使用SVG图标和图标库的技巧:
SVG组件:Vue中可以创建一个可重复使用的SVG组件,用于显示单个SVG图标。通过在组件中使用<path>
等SVG元素,可以轻松地渲染SVG图标。
图标库组件:某些图标库提供了专门的Vue组件,可以更方便地使用图标库中的图标。通过导入图标库组件,并使用特定的图标标识,我们可以在应用程序中快速插入图标。
打包优化:在使用大型图标库时,我们应该注意打包优化。一些图标库支持按需加载图标,只引入应用程序中使用的图标,以减少打包体积。
自定义图标库:如果需要自定义图标,我们可以使用工具如Iconfont来创建自己的图标库。这允许我们上传自己的SVG图标,并生成相应的图标库供使用。
通过合理使用SVG图标和图标库,我们可以提升Vue应用程序的视觉效果和用户体验。希望本文对您理解和应用Vue中的SVG图标和图标库使用有所帮助。
.